About 21 Ash Grove
21 Ash Grove is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Ilkley (LS29 8EP). It has a recorded floor area of 100 m² (around 1076 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2012)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from July 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 1995–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£386,000 is 18.8%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£302/sq ft) was about 51.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old January 2021 for £324,950.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
